Servings: 4-6

*Ingredients*
- 8 oz. pasta of your choice (e.g., penne, fusilli, or farfalle)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 onion, diced
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 2 cups fresh tomatoes, diced (or 1 can of crushed tomatoes)
- 1 cup tomato puree
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1 cup grated m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1 tablespoon butter
*Instructions*
1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
2. Cook the pasta al dente, according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
3.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and cook until translucent (3-4 minutes).
4.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ional minute, until fragrant.
5. Add the diced tomatoes, tomato puree, dried basil, and dried oregano.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Simmer the sauce for 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ally.
6. In a large bowl, combine the cooked pasta, tomato sauce, and chopped parsley. Mix well to combine.
7. In a greased 9x13-inch baking dish, arrange half of the pasta mixture. Top with half of the mozzarella cheese and half of the parmesan cheese.
8. Repeat the layers, starting with the remaining pasta mixture, then the remaining mozzarella cheese, and finally the remaining parmesan cheese.
9. Dot the top of the cheese with butter.
10.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ake for 25 minutes.
11. Remove the foil and continue baking for an additional 10-15 minutes, until the cheese is golden brown and bubbly.
12. Remove from the oven and let it rest for 10-15 minutes before serving.
*Tips and Variations*
- Use fresh tomatoes during peak season for the best flavor.
- Add protein like cooked chicken, sausage, or bacon for added flavor.
- Mix in some chopped bell peppers or mushrooms for extra nutrients.
- Substitute other types of cheese, like ricotta or gorgonzola, for a unique twist.
